
February 2026 Rental and Investment News: Massapequa Park, NY
Rental and investment activity in Massapequa Park, NY offers a focused look at opportunities this February 2026. Are you curious how rental and investment properties are performing alongside a strong sales market?
Closed lease transactions remain limited, with only two recent single family homes leased at $4,200 per month. Inventory remains extremely tight, and with a median home value of $782,670 (up 5.6 percent year-over-year), Massapequa Park, NY’s appeal to both investors and residents endures. Why does this matter? Supply constraints make the market especially competitive for investment buyers and renters alike.
Current Rental Details and Trends
While the rental sample is small, individual home leases feature three bedrooms at $4,200, with sizes between 1,066 and 1,450 square feet. Median days listed for rental homes averages 22, showing units go quickly when available. No aggregate rental rates or vacancy trends can be reported, but each new rental provides important reference points for future investors and tenants.
